The Cost of Funerals in Singapore
It’s important to know the costs of funerals in Singapore for good planning. The prices can change a lot based on different things. Families need to know the average costs and what services are available. This helps them make better choices.
Also, knowing what affects funeral costs can help avoid surprises. This is important during a hard time.
Average Costs of Different Services
The cost of a funeral in Singapore can be between S$4,000 and S$11,000. Hiring a funeral director can cost between S$4,000 and S$8,000 or more. There are also extra fees:
Service | Average Cost (S$) |
---|---|
Repatriation of Body | 5,000 – 15,000 |
Certificate of Cause of Death | 250 – 300 |
CPF Nomination | 200 – 500 |
Lawyer to Draft Will | 200 – 500 |
Burial Costs | 4,733.27 – 7,099.48 |
Non-Religious Ceremony | 3,999.00 |
Taoist Ceremony | 8,214.36 |
Things like flower arrangements can also add to the cost. For example, a bouquet of roses might cost around S$83.40. Families should think about their budget and what services they want.
Factors Influencing Funeral Costs
Many things can affect the cost of a funeral in Singapore. The choice between burial or cremation, the funeral parlour, and extra requests from family members are important. Personal touches and preferences can also change the price.
For example, HDB funerals are cheaper than those in commercial parlours, saving about 13%. Without planning and burial costs insurance, families might face unexpected costs. This can be hard when they’re already feeling emotional stress.
What is Funeral Insurance?
Funeral insurance is a special kind of life insurance. It helps cover the costs of funerals. When someone dies, it pays out a set amount to help with burial or cremation costs.
In Singapore, funeral insurance is often part of whole life insurance policies. It covers not just funeral costs but also debts like medical bills and mortgages. There’s also preneed funeral insurance that pays funeral homes directly, making things easier for families.
Policies for funeral insurance offer a tax-free death benefit. This helps beneficiaries pay for funeral costs and other bills. The coverage amount starts at $5,000 and can go up to $15,000, helping many families.
- Funeral insurance premiums stay the same, giving peace of mind.
- Some policies require two years of premium payments before benefits start.
- People can keep getting burial insurance until they’re 100 years old.
Some say burial insurance targets low-income and less educated people. But it’s available to many. Those with serious health issues might find better options in term or permanent life insurance.

Types of Insurance Policies for Funeral Expenses
When planning for funeral costs, there are several insurance options. These include term life and whole life insurance. Each offers unique features to help families cover end-of-life expenses.
Term Life Insurance
Term life insurance lasts from 10 to 30 years. It’s a good choice for families needing financial help for funeral costs if the policyholder dies during this time. Make sure the coverage amount can pay for funeral expenses, which averaged $7,848 in 2021.
Keep in mind, term life insurance ends after the set term. This means you need to plan carefully to ensure coverage when needed.
Whole Life Insurance
Whole life insurance covers you for life and also grows a savings account. This can help with funeral costs or provide a death benefit. While it costs more than term insurance, it offers long-term financial security.
Whole life policies often have a large death benefit. This can help ease the financial burden on your loved ones.
Type of Insurance | Duration | Premiums | Benefit |
---|---|---|---|
Term Life Insurance | 10 to 30 years | Lower premiums | Death benefit for funeral costs if within term |
Whole Life Insurance | Lifetime | Higher premiums | Cash value accumulation & higher death benefits |

The Lack of Funeral Insurance Options in Singapore
In Singapore, finding funeral insurance is tough. Funeral costs are going up, but there aren’t many choices. This leaves people without a plan for the cost of saying goodbye.
People are often unsure about their funeral insurance. Many think a full funeral will cost under S$1,000. But, in reality, most spend between S$5,000 and S$8,999.
Planning ahead can ease worries, but finding good insurance is hard. Without clear choices, making informed decisions is tough. Many are confused by prices and feel misled by funeral service providers.
It’s important to know what your life insurance covers. Many are unaware of their funeral coverage, making it hard to plan. This adds to the challenges of finding the right funeral insurance in Singapore.

Addressing Cultural Sensitivity in Funeral Planning
In Singapore, understanding Singapore funeral customs is key. It helps funeral providers handle the emotional side of death and mourning. This knowledge is vital for respecting different traditions.
Funeral plans must consider various customs. This includes how the body is prepared and the type of memorial service. Knowing these customs helps funeral providers honor the deceased and support the family.
It’s important to talk with families about their cultural needs. This shows respect for their beliefs and creates a caring environment. By working together, families can face their grief with dignity.
Here’s a summary of essential cultural considerations in funeral planning:
Cultural Framework | Key Practices | Provider Role |
---|---|---|
Chinese | Involvement of family, three days of mourning | Facilitator of family discussions |
Malay | Quick burial, recitation of prayers | Support for religious observances |
Indian | Cremation, rituals performed by priests | Customizing arrangements with cultural significance |
Christian | Wake services, memorial services | Coordinating with religious leaders |
Understanding cultural sensitivity in funerals makes the experience richer. It honors the deceased in a way that touches the families’ hearts. Each culture adds its own meaning, showing the value of personalized care in funeral planning.
